usb: host: ehci-dbg: add function output_buf_tds_dir()



This patch fixes a coding style issue reported by checkpatch related to
too many leading tabs.

This moves part of the fill_periodic_buffer() to the new function
output_buf_tds_dir().

Because it's inline, the file size has not changed.

Before:
  text	data  bss    dec   hex	filename
 36920    81   12  37013  9095  drivers/usb/host/ehci-hcd.o

After:
  text	data  bss    dec   hex	filename
 36920    81   12  37013  9095  drivers/usb/host/ehci-hcd.o
